Many players get stuck right at the start because of the inventory and "Use" mode mechanics. Tutorial 1: Wake Up and Reactivate:
To interact with buttons, you must select your item (box icon or 'i'), then click the Quick Select icon
(or press 'b') to enter "Use" mode. Use your Hyper-Wrench on the terminal button to wake up the ship. Tutorial 2: Captain’s Wrist Unit:
You cannot take command without the Wrist Control Unit. Look in the cabinet on the right side of the screen in the Captain’s Cabin Tutorial 3: Engine Fix: If the engines won't start, search the Tunneling Modules
found in the engine room crates. Access the configuration terminal to install them before attempting to fly to the space station. Mid-Game Quests & Common "Blocks" The Arellarti Mission Block: This was the number one reason players searched
If T’Ris won't give you the green light for the "Go to Arellarti" mission, check that everyone (including Vee) has a Krell uniform. The Pirate Base:
This is a hidden location. To reveal it, you must manufacture an illegal bot (IQ > 140) in the Bot Lab and then chat with Nimhe. Jumpgate Access:
You need a Jump License from Iltari Station. Since you won't have a Multipass, you can either bribe them with a case of Voronian Vortex
(requires 6 bottles) or pay a shady trader 1 million credits. Mining & Resource Management Mining Laser Setup:
Get the mining laser from Station Control. Install it at the Cargo Bay terminal under the "Subsystems" tab, then configure it in the engine room (EN). Promethium Ore:
This rare ore is required for the Uplink quest. You cannot buy it; you must have a Mining Laser MKII
and access to the Outer Belt, or find it during a "ship in distress" event. The Bot Lab Essentials IQ & Sales:
